This is to announce that the Florida GLBT Democratic Caucus will hold it's Summer Membership Meeting at the Diplomat Hotel, Meeting Room 202 from 9 AM to 11:30 AM on Saturday, July 14th.
We will be providing, at least, a continental breakfast starting at 8 AM. There will be a $35 Member Registration Fee ($20 for Members who are students) for the morning Membership Meeting, which will include breakfast. The Non-Member Registration Fee is $50 ($35 for Non-Member Students).
When planning this meeting, we discussed holding a Coalition Building Session, continuing what the Black Caucus started at their Convention in May and inviting other Democratic Caucuses, especially the Black, Hispanic and Disability Caucuses to participate. I am happy to say that on the JJ 'Tentative' Schedule (see attached), sponsored by the FDP, there will be a 'Caucus of the Caucuses' session as part of the Affirmative Action Committee Meeting from 2:30 to 4 PM Saturday afternoon. This meeting will involve all Caucus Presidents/Chairs and is open to all Democrats. We will be participating in this session, and I would encourage all of you to plan on attending. The GLBT Caucus will gather back together in Meeting Room 303 at 4 PM. We will adjourn at 5 PM to get ready ('pretty up') for the JJ Dinner.
The GLBT Caucus has reserved 2 tables for the JJ Dinner, so please plan to sit with the Caucus, at the DEC rate of $150. If you've already purchased your tickets, please let us know so we can put your name on the list we submit to the FDP.
